| /linux/drivers/reset/ |
| H A D | reset-eyeq.c | 145 u32 valid_mask; member 393 !(priv->data->domains[domain].valid_mask & BIT(offset))) { in eqr_of_xlate_internal() 474 priv->rcdev.nr_resets += hweight32(priv->data->domains[i].valid_mask); in eqr_probe() 486 .valid_mask = 0xFFFFFF8, 491 .valid_mask = 0x0001FFF, 496 .valid_mask = 0x007BFFF, 509 .valid_mask = 0x3FFF, 514 .valid_mask = 0x00FF, 528 .valid_mask = 0x1F7F, 541 .valid_mask = 0x7FFF,
|
| /linux/drivers/bus/ |
| H A D | brcmstb_gisb.c | 147 u32 valid_mask; member 244 u32 mask = gdev->valid_mask & masters; in brcmstb_gisb_master_to_str() 467 &gdev->valid_mask)) in brcmstb_gisb_arb_probe() 468 gdev->valid_mask = 0xffffffff; in brcmstb_gisb_arb_probe() 475 if (hweight_long(gdev->valid_mask) == num_masters) { in brcmstb_gisb_arb_probe() 476 first = ffs(gdev->valid_mask) - 1; in brcmstb_gisb_arb_probe() 477 last = fls(gdev->valid_mask) - 1; in brcmstb_gisb_arb_probe() 480 if (!(gdev->valid_mask & BIT(i))) in brcmstb_gisb_arb_probe()
|
| /linux/drivers/gpu/drm/amd/include/ |
| H A D | amd_cper.h | 113 uint32_t valid_mask; member 138 uint8_t valid_mask; member 165 uint64_t valid_mask; member 182 uint64_t valid_mask; member
|
| /linux/drivers/irqchip/ |
| H A D | irq-versatile-fpga.c | 206 u32 valid_mask; in fpga_irq_of_init() local 218 if (of_property_read_u32(node, "valid-mask", &valid_mask)) in fpga_irq_of_init() 219 valid_mask = 0; in fpga_irq_of_init() 231 fpga_irq_init(base, parent_irq, valid_mask, node); in fpga_irq_of_init()
|
| H A D | irq-bcm7120-l2.c | 104 int irq, u32 *valid_mask) in bcm7120_l2_intc_init_one() argument 133 valid_mask[idx] |= l1_data->irq_map_mask[idx]; in bcm7120_l2_intc_init_one() 221 u32 valid_mask[MAX_WORDS] = { }; in bcm7120_l2_intc_probe() local 247 ret = bcm7120_l2_intc_init_one(dn, data, irq, valid_mask); in bcm7120_l2_intc_probe() 278 gc->unused = 0xffffffff & ~valid_mask[idx]; in bcm7120_l2_intc_probe()
|
| /linux/drivers/gpio/ |
| H A D | gpio-bd71815.c | 112 unsigned long *valid_mask, in bd71815_init_valid_mask() argument 120 *valid_mask = BD71815_TWO_GPIOS; in bd71815_init_valid_mask() 122 *valid_mask = BD71815_ONE_GPIO; in bd71815_init_valid_mask()
|
| H A D | gpio-ljca.c | 231 unsigned long *valid_mask, in ljca_gpio_init_valid_mask() argument 237 bitmap_copy(valid_mask, ljca_gpio->gpio_info->valid_pin_map, ngpios); in ljca_gpio_init_valid_mask() 243 unsigned long *valid_mask, in ljca_gpio_irq_init_valid_mask() argument 246 ljca_gpio_init_valid_mask(chip, valid_mask, ngpios); in ljca_gpio_irq_init_valid_mask()
|
| H A D | gpio-rcar.c | 482 const unsigned long *valid_mask; in gpio_rcar_enable_inputs() local 484 valid_mask = gpiochip_query_valid_mask(&p->gpio_chip); in gpio_rcar_enable_inputs() 487 if (valid_mask) in gpio_rcar_enable_inputs() 488 mask &= valid_mask[0]; in gpio_rcar_enable_inputs()
|
| H A D | gpio-aggregator.c | 250 unsigned long *valid_mask; member 263 return test_bit(offset, fwd->valid_mask) ? 0 : -ENODEV; in gpio_fwd_request() 274 if (!test_bit(offset, fwd->valid_mask)) in gpio_fwd_get_direction() 709 fwd->valid_mask = devm_bitmap_zalloc(dev, ngpios, GFP_KERNEL); in devm_gpiochip_fwd_alloc() 710 if (!fwd->valid_mask) in devm_gpiochip_fwd_alloc() 751 if (test_and_set_bit(offset, fwd->valid_mask)) in gpiochip_fwd_desc_add() 777 if (test_and_clear_bit(offset, fwd->valid_mask)) in gpiochip_fwd_desc_free() 797 if (!bitmap_full(fwd->valid_mask, chip->ngpio)) in gpiochip_fwd_register()
|
| H A D | gpio-mpsse.c | 559 unsigned long *valid_mask, in mpsse_init_valid_mask() argument 567 *valid_mask = priv->dir_in | priv->dir_out; in mpsse_init_valid_mask() 573 unsigned long *valid_mask, in mpsse_irq_init_valid_mask() argument 582 *valid_mask = priv->dir_in; in mpsse_irq_init_valid_mask()
|
| H A D | gpio-npcm-sgpio.c | 307 unsigned long *valid_mask, in npcm_sgpio_irq_init_valid_mask() argument 313 bitmap_set(valid_mask, gpio->nout_sgpio, gpio->nin_sgpio); in npcm_sgpio_irq_init_valid_mask() 314 bitmap_clear(valid_mask, 0, gpio->nout_sgpio); in npcm_sgpio_irq_init_valid_mask()
|
| H A D | gpiolib.c | 741 bitmap_clear(gc->gpiodev->valid_mask, start, count); in gpiochip_apply_reserved_ranges() 755 gc->gpiodev->valid_mask = gpiochip_allocate_mask(gc); in gpiochip_init_valid_mask() 756 if (!gc->gpiodev->valid_mask) in gpiochip_init_valid_mask() 765 gc->gpiodev->valid_mask, in gpiochip_init_valid_mask() 773 gpiochip_free_mask(&gc->gpiodev->valid_mask); in gpiochip_free_valid_mask() 799 * available. These chips can have valid_mask set to represent the valid 804 return gc->gpiodev->valid_mask; in gpiochip_query_valid_mask() 818 if (likely(!gc->gpiodev->valid_mask)) in gpiochip_line_is_valid() 820 return test_bit(offset, gc->gpiodev->valid_mask); in gpiochip_line_is_valid() 1479 girq->valid_mask in gpiochip_irqchip_init_valid_mask() [all...] |
| H A D | gpiolib.h | 69 unsigned long *valid_mask; member
|
| /linux/arch/mips/cavium-octeon/executive/ |
| H A D | cvmx-l2c.c | 87 uint32_t valid_mask; in cvmx_l2c_set_core_way_partition() local 89 valid_mask = (0x1 << cvmx_l2c_get_num_assoc()) - 1; in cvmx_l2c_set_core_way_partition() 91 mask &= valid_mask; in cvmx_l2c_set_core_way_partition() 94 if (mask == valid_mask && !OCTEON_IS_MODEL(OCTEON_CN63XX)) in cvmx_l2c_set_core_way_partition() 144 uint32_t valid_mask; in cvmx_l2c_set_hw_way_partition() local 146 valid_mask = (0x1 << cvmx_l2c_get_num_assoc()) - 1; in cvmx_l2c_set_hw_way_partition() 147 mask &= valid_mask; in cvmx_l2c_set_hw_way_partition() 150 if (mask == valid_mask && !OCTEON_IS_MODEL(OCTEON_CN63XX)) in cvmx_l2c_set_hw_way_partition()
|
| /linux/arch/arm64/kernel/ |
| H A D | process.c | 853 unsigned long valid_mask = PR_TAGGED_ADDR_ENABLE; in set_tagged_addr_ctrl() local 860 valid_mask |= PR_MTE_TCF_SYNC | PR_MTE_TCF_ASYNC \ in set_tagged_addr_ctrl() 864 valid_mask |= PR_MTE_STORE_ONLY; in set_tagged_addr_ctrl() 867 if (arg & ~valid_mask) in set_tagged_addr_ctrl()
|
| /linux/drivers/platform/cznic/ |
| H A D | turris-omnia-mcu-gpio.c | 522 unsigned long *valid_mask, in omnia_gpio_init_valid_mask() argument 531 __assign_bit(i, valid_mask, in omnia_gpio_init_valid_mask() 534 __clear_bit(i, valid_mask); in omnia_gpio_init_valid_mask() 738 unsigned long *valid_mask, in omnia_irq_init_valid_mask() argument 747 __assign_bit(i, valid_mask, in omnia_irq_init_valid_mask() 750 __clear_bit(i, valid_mask); in omnia_irq_init_valid_mask()
|
| /linux/drivers/gpu/drm/imagination/ |
| H A D | pvr_stream_defs.c | 80 .valid_mask = PVR_STREAM_EXTHDR_GEOM0_VALID, 161 .valid_mask = PVR_STREAM_EXTHDR_FRAG0_VALID, 218 .valid_mask = PVR_STREAM_EXTHDR_COMPUTE0_VALID,
|
| H A D | pvr_stream.h | 54 u32 valid_mask; member
|
| /linux/arch/alpha/kernel/ |
| H A D | err_marvel.c | 140 marvel_print_po7_uncrr_sym(u64 uncrr_sym, u64 valid_mask) in marvel_print_po7_uncrr_sym() argument 187 uncrr_sym &= valid_mask; in marvel_print_po7_uncrr_sym() 189 if (EXTRACT(valid_mask, IO7__PO7_UNCRR_SYM__SYN)) in marvel_print_po7_uncrr_sym() 194 if (EXTRACT(valid_mask, IO7__PO7_UNCRR_SYM__ERR_CYC)) in marvel_print_po7_uncrr_sym() 255 if (EXTRACT(valid_mask, IO7__PO7_UNCRR_SYM__STRV_VTR)) { in marvel_print_po7_uncrr_sym()
|
| /linux/include/linux/gpio/ |
| H A D | regmap.h | 105 unsigned long *valid_mask,
|
| /linux/drivers/pinctrl/qcom/ |
| H A D | pinctrl-msm.c | 717 unsigned long *valid_mask, in msm_gpio_init_valid_mask() argument 733 clear_bit(reserved[i], valid_mask); in msm_gpio_init_valid_mask() 757 bitmap_zero(valid_mask, ngpios); in msm_gpio_init_valid_mask() 759 set_bit(tmp[i], valid_mask); in msm_gpio_init_valid_mask() 1018 unsigned long *valid_mask, in msm_gpio_irq_init_valid_mask() argument 1025 bitmap_fill(valid_mask, ngpios); in msm_gpio_irq_init_valid_mask() 1032 clear_bit(i, valid_mask); in msm_gpio_irq_init_valid_mask()
|
| /linux/drivers/gpu/drm/ |
| H A D | drm_property.c | 966 uint64_t valid_mask = 0; in drm_property_change_valid_get() local 969 valid_mask |= (1ULL << property->values[i]); in drm_property_change_valid_get() 970 return !(value & ~valid_mask); in drm_property_change_valid_get()
|
| /linux/drivers/iio/adc/ |
| H A D | rohm-bd79112.c | 233 unsigned long *valid_mask, in bd79112_gpio_init_valid_mask() argument 238 *valid_mask = data->gpio_valid_mask; in bd79112_gpio_init_valid_mask()
|
| /linux/arch/x86/events/amd/ |
| H A D | ibs.c | 89 u64 valid_mask; member 549 config &= ~perf_ibs->valid_mask; in perf_ibs_stop() 801 .valid_mask = IBS_FETCH_VAL, 827 .valid_mask = IBS_OP_VAL, 1261 if (!(*buf++ & perf_ibs->valid_mask)) in perf_ibs_handle_irq()
|
| /linux/include/uapi/linux/ |
| H A D | isst_if.h | 256 __u16 valid_mask; member
|